yes, with wavecom you have two options, wither you can program the modem itself or you can use AT commands.

WIP provides TCP/IP stack for your modem to make things work.

but to start with...

well now i remember... WMOD was a name used by wavecom some time ago..

now it has changed to fasttrack..
the fasttrack supreme costs around 6k+
whereas the same modem Q24Plus wud cost u half of it.. so next time remmeber to choose q24plus

anyways..

connect to hyperterminal and check version of firmware..

u will find either 655 or 657 kinda response..
please let us know the exact response..

now since you are using the name WMOD your firmware might be the old 655 which doesnt support WIP (shailesh plz. correct me if wrong)..

but there is a different option with it.

you could use edsoft library for the HTTP and all other issues..

now to obtain the software (OPen AT suite)...
u neednt download it.. it is distributed free of cost, but after an NDA signed by wavecom and you..
ask your dealer more about it.

if u get hold that suite.. the programming will be relatively easier

use ATI3 to get firmware version.

If you use openAT suit you will feel its much simpler to use and with lesser components on board.
